Takeo is a Japanese given name that has deep cultural roots and historical significance. The name Takeo is derived from the Japanese words "take" meaning "bamboo" and "o" meaning "man," resulting in the meaning "bamboo man" or "strong as bamboo." In Japanese culture, bamboo is seen as a symbol of strength, resilience, and flexibility, making Takeo a name that conveys qualities of endurance and fortitude. In Japan, names hold a special importance and are often chosen based on their meanings and symbolism. The name Takeo is commonly given to boys in Japan, reflecting the desire for them to embody the characteristics of bamboo - strong, upright, and adaptable in the face of challenges. Historically, the name Takeo has been used by various notable figures in Japanese society, including samurais, poets, and artists. The name has also been featured in literature and popular culture, further cementing its place in Japanese tradition. Overall, Takeo is a name that carries a sense of tradition, strength, and cultural significance within Japanese society.
